size and rotation invariant model for the recognition of grey scale images abstract

A model for the recognition of grey scale images has been proposed which is invariant to translation scale position and rotation invariancy is mainly achieved by a projection method based on the proposed modified radon transform the modified radon transform has attractive feature reduction properties a fast feature extractor based on the rapid transform has been adoted which makes the output of the projection stage rotationinvariant the model has been tested on two sets of grey scale planar shapes with satisfactory results achieved.
